Timeline for Physical Therapy
A typical physical therapy timeline for an ankle fracture is generally between 6 to 12 weeks, although individual timelines can vary. Factors influencing the duration include the type of fracture, the patient’s overall health, and adherence to the prescribed therapy plan. The therapist will carefully monitor progress and adjust the program as needed to ensure optimal outcomes.

Phase | Goals |
---|---|
Initial Phase (Weeks 1-4) | Focus on pain management, minimizing swelling, and restoring ankle range of motion. Exercises will include gentle range-of-motion exercises, light ankle pumps, and isometric exercises to maintain muscle tone. |
Intermediate Phase (Weeks 5-8) | Gradually increasing strength and stability. This phase will incorporate exercises that target specific muscles around the ankle, improving balance, and potentially using resistance bands or weights. |
Advanced Phase (Weeks 9-12) | Preparing for return to activities. Exercises will focus on functional movements like walking, stair climbing, and sports-specific drills. Emphasis on proprioception (awareness of body position) and agility training. |

Range of Motion Exercises
Regaining ankle range of motion (ROM) is paramount during the initial phase. This involves gentle, controlled movements to restore flexibility and prevent stiffness. Exercises typically begin with passive movements, where a therapist assists in moving the ankle joint through its available range. As pain and swelling subside, active exercises are introduced, encouraging the patient to actively participate in the movements.
Progressive exercises, like ankle pumps and circles, gradually increase the range of motion.

Role of Assistive Devices
Assistive devices, such as crutches or braces, play a significant role in the initial phase. They provide support and reduce stress on the injured ankle, allowing for controlled weight-bearing and preventing further injury. Crutches are commonly used to limit weight on the ankle, while braces provide stability and support. Proper use of these devices is crucial to avoid complications and promote healing.
The progression from crutches to minimal support or no support is carefully monitored by the physical therapist, guided by the patient’s pain tolerance and progress.

Strengthening Exercises
This phase introduces resistance exercises to build strength in the ankle, foot, and surrounding muscles. These exercises progressively increase the load on the ankle joint, improving its ability to handle stress. Crucial muscles targeted include the anterior tibialis, posterior tibialis, peroneals, and gastrocnemius. These muscles are essential for proper ankle function.
- Ankle Pumps: Using resistance bands or weights, perform ankle pumps in various directions (dorsiflexion, plantar flexion, inversion, eversion) to strengthen the involved muscles. Start with light resistance and gradually increase the load as strength improves. The number of repetitions and sets should be adjusted based on individual progress and pain tolerance.
- Toe Raises and Curls: These exercises target the intrinsic foot muscles. They can be performed with or without weights, and focus on strengthening muscles responsible for lifting and moving the toes.
- Resistance Band Exercises: Incorporate resistance band exercises like ankle plantar flexion, dorsiflexion, and eversion/inversion. Resistance bands provide a controlled way to progressively increase resistance.
- Weight-bearing Exercises: Progress to weight-bearing exercises such as calf raises, heel raises, and toe raises on a stable surface to gradually increase load.
Improving Balance and Proprioception
Improving balance and proprioception is crucial for preventing falls and restoring confidence in using the ankle. Exercises should focus on challenging the ankle’s ability to adapt to changing positions and support the body.
- Single-Leg Balance Exercises: Practice balancing on one leg with eyes open and closed, progressively increasing the duration and difficulty. This can be done on a stable surface or a slightly unstable surface like a foam pad. The duration of each balance attempt should increase with progress.
- Balance Board Exercises: Use balance boards to challenge the ankle’s ability to adapt to various positions and forces. Begin with basic standing exercises and gradually increase the instability of the board.
- Walking on Uneven Surfaces: Gradually transition to walking on uneven surfaces like grass or gravel to further challenge balance and proprioception. This provides real-world practice.
Increasing Ankle Stability
This involves exercises that improve the joint’s ability to withstand stress and maintain its position. It’s essential for preventing future injuries.
- Theraband Exercises: Incorporate theraband exercises for inversion and eversion to improve the strength and stability of the ankle ligaments. This enhances the ankle’s ability to withstand stress and maintain its position.
- Proprioceptive Exercises: Exercises like ankle taps, wobble board exercises, and balance exercises on unstable surfaces improve the ankle’s awareness of its position and movement. This helps to develop the body’s sense of where its limbs are in space.
Improving Functional Mobility
This phase introduces activities that mimic everyday movements to improve the ankle’s functional capacity.
- Walking and Stair Climbing: Gradually increase the distance and duration of walking, incorporating stair climbing as tolerated. The focus is on proper gait mechanics and ensuring minimal pain.
- Light Jogging: Introduce light jogging on flat surfaces, monitoring for pain and adjusting the intensity as needed. This is important to restore functional mobility and prepares for higher-impact activities.
- Sport-Specific Activities: If applicable, gradually incorporate sport-specific movements, like cutting, pivoting, and jumping, under supervision, ensuring proper technique and gradual progression.

Potential Complications
Potential complications following an ankle fracture can significantly impact recovery time and the final outcome. Common complications include pain, stiffness, delayed healing, and the potential for developing chronic ankle instability. Understanding these potential issues is crucial for developing a proactive approach to recovery.
- Pain: Persistent or worsening pain can be a significant setback. This could be due to factors like improper healing, ongoing inflammation, or the development of nerve impingement. Early intervention and management strategies are essential to minimize pain and maximize mobility.
- Stiffness: Limited range of motion is a frequent concern. This can arise from a combination of factors, including inflammation, scar tissue formation, and lack of appropriate exercises. Addressing stiffness early through targeted exercises and mobilization techniques is critical for regaining full function.
- Delayed Healing: Sometimes, the fracture may not heal as expected. This could be due to various factors such as poor blood supply, inadequate immobilization, or underlying medical conditions. Careful monitoring and adherence to the prescribed treatment plan are vital to facilitate proper healing.
- Chronic Ankle Instability: This condition can develop if the supporting ligaments are not adequately repaired or rehabilitated during the recovery process. Early identification and treatment strategies are essential to prevent this complication.

Ankle Pumps
Ankle pumps are essential for regaining ankle mobility and flexibility. These exercises are generally the first steps in rehabilitation, focusing on the ankle joint itself.
- Sitting or standing, slowly flex and extend your ankle, lifting your toes and then pointing your foot downward. Maintain a slow and controlled motion, ensuring your movement is smooth and doesn’t cause any pain.
- Repeat this motion 10-15 times, 3-4 times a day. Gradually increase the repetitions as your range of motion improves.
- Modification: For individuals with limited mobility or severe pain, the exercise can be performed with a light resistance band around the foot to aid movement.
Range of Motion Exercises
These exercises aim to restore the full range of motion in the ankle joint, enabling you to perform daily tasks more easily.
- Dorsiflexion: Gently pull your toes upwards towards your shin. Hold for a few seconds, then release.
- Plantarflexion: Gently point your toes downwards away from your shin. Hold for a few seconds, then release.
- Inversion: Turn your foot inward, bringing the sole of your foot towards the other leg. Hold for a few seconds, then release.
- Eversion: Turn your foot outward, bringing the outside of your foot away from the other leg. Hold for a few seconds, then release.
- Modification: For individuals with limited mobility, use a towel or strap to assist in the movement. Gradually increase the range of motion as pain subsides and mobility improves.
Strengthening Exercises
These exercises are crucial for building strength in the muscles surrounding the ankle joint, improving stability and preventing future injuries.
- Ankle Plantarflexion and Dorsiflexion with Resistance Band: Wrap a resistance band around the ball of your foot. Resist the band as you lift your foot up (dorsiflexion) and push your foot down (plantarflexion). Repeat 10-15 times, 2-3 sets.
- Ankle Abduction and Adduction with Resistance Band: Wrap the resistance band around the ankle and move your foot out (abduction) and in (adduction). Repeat 10-15 times, 2-3 sets.
- Modification: For those with limited strength, use a lighter resistance band or perform the exercises without any resistance. Increase the resistance gradually as strength improves.
